Also known as PancakeSwap 2.0, it offers lower fees and faster confirmation times compared to the original version. Binance Smart Chain, the high‑throughput blockchain that hosts PancakeSwap v2 provides the underlying speed, while AMM, the pricing algorithm that automatically matches trades without order books drives price discovery. Liquidity pools, collections of token pairs that users lock up to enable swapping and earn fees are the fuel for the whole system. In short, PancakeSwap v2 combines these pieces to create a low‑cost, user‑friendly DeFi hub on BSC.
The platform’s yield farming feature lets LP providers stake their pool tokens to earn CAKE rewards, which many of our articles break down in plain terms. Compared with centralized exchanges like OKX or CoinW, PancakeSwap v2 keeps custody in the user’s wallet, removing a big security risk.
